Summary

A BILL To be entitled an Act to amend an Act to incorporate the City of Milton in Fulton County, Georgia, approved March 29, 2006 (Ga. L. 2006, p. 3554), as amended, so as to change the description of the election districts for the city council; to provide for definitions and inclusions; to provide for manner of election; to provide for the continuation in office of current members; to provide for related matters;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.
